165/* Use ENTRY_TOCLESS for functions that make no use of r2 and
166 guarantee r2 is unchanged on exit. Any function that has @toc or
167 @got relocs uses r2. Functions that call other functions via the
168 PLT use r2. Use ENTRY for functions that may use or change r2.
169 The first argument is the function name.
170 The optional second argument specifies alignment of the function's
171 code, as the logarithm base two of the byte alignment. For
172 example, a value of four aligns to a sixteen byte boundary.
173 The optional third argument specifies the number of NOPs to emit
174 before the start of the function's code. */
175#ifndef PROF
176#define ENTRY_TOCLESS(name, ...) \
177 ENTRY_3 name, ## __VA_ARGS__; \
178 cfi_startproc
179
180#define ENTRY(name, ...) \
181 ENTRY_TOCLESS(name, ## __VA_ARGS__); \
182 LOCALENTRY(name)
183#else
184/* The call to _mcount is potentially via the plt, so profiling code
185 is never free of an r2 use. */
186#define ENTRY_TOCLESS(name, ...) \
187 ENTRY_3 name, ## __VA_ARGS__; \
188 cfi_startproc; \
189 LOCALENTRY(name)
190
191#define ENTRY(name, ...) \
192 ENTRY_TOCLESS(name, ## __VA_ARGS__)
193#endif

267/* We will allocate a new frame to save LR and the non-volatile register used to
268 read the TCB when checking for scv support on syscall code. We actually just
269 need the minimum frame size plus room for 1 reg (8 bytes). But the ABI
270 mandates stack frames should be aligned at 16 Bytes, so we end up allocating
271 a bit more space then what will actually be used. */
272#define SCV_FRAME_SIZE (FRAME_MIN_SIZE+16)
273#define SCV_FRAME_NVOLREG_SAVE FRAME_MIN_SIZE
274
275/* Allocate frame and save register */
276#define NVOLREG_SAVE \
277 stdu r1,-SCV_FRAME_SIZE(r1); \
278 cfi_adjust_cfa_offset(SCV_FRAME_SIZE); \
279 std r31,SCV_FRAME_NVOLREG_SAVE(r1); \
280 cfi_rel_offset(r31,SCV_FRAME_NVOLREG_SAVE);
281
282/* Restore register and destroy frame */
283#define NVOLREG_RESTORE \
284 ld r31,SCV_FRAME_NVOLREG_SAVE(r1); \
285 cfi_restore(r31); \
286 addi r1,r1,SCV_FRAME_SIZE; \
287 cfi_adjust_cfa_offset(-SCV_FRAME_SIZE);
288
289/* Check PPC_FEATURE2_SCV bit from hwcap2 in the TCB. If it is not set, scv is
290 not available, then go to JUMPFALSE (label given by the macro's caller). We
291 save the value we read from the TCB in a non-volatile register so we can
292 reuse it later when exiting from the syscall in PSEUDO_RET. Note that for
293 the static case we need an extra check to guarantee the thread pointer has
294 already been initialized, otherwise we may try to access an invalid address
295 if a syscall is called before the TLS has been setup. */
296 .macro CHECK_SCV_SUPPORT REG JUMPFALSE
297
298#ifndef SHARED
299 /* Check if thread pointer has already been setup. */
300 cmpdi r13,0
301 beq \JUMPFALSE
302#endif
303
304 /* Read PPC_FEATURE2_SCV from TCB and store it in REG */
305 ld \REG,TCB_HWCAP(PT_THREAD_POINTER)
306 andis. \REG,\REG,PPC_FEATURE2_SCV>>16
307
308 beq \JUMPFALSE
309 .endm
310
311#if !defined(USE_PPC_SCV) || IS_IN(rtld)
312# define DO_CALL(syscall) \
313 li r0,syscall; \
314 DO_CALL_SC
315#else
316/* Before doing the syscall, check if we can use scv. scv is supported by P9
317 and later with Linux v5.9 and later. If so, use it. Otherwise, fallback to
318 sc. We use a non-volatile register to save hwcap2 from the TCB, so we need
319 to save its content beforehand. */
320# define DO_CALL(syscall) \
321 li r0,syscall; \
322 NVOLREG_SAVE; \
323 CHECK_SCV_SUPPORT r31 0f; \
324 DO_CALL_SCV; \
325 b 1f; \
3260: DO_CALL_SC; \
3271:
328#endif /* !defined(USE_PPC_SCV) || IS_IN(rtld) */
